Correcting pronunciation errors is a vital part of language learning. Traditional methods often involve repetitive drills and correction by teachers, which can sometimes lead to student frustration. Innovative approaches focusing on dialogue practice can make pronunciation correction more engaging and effective.
The Importance of Dialogue in Language Learning
Dialogue-based learning immerses students in real-life conversational contexts. It encourages active participation, listening, and immediate feedback, all of which are essential for mastering pronunciation. Through dialogue, learners can hear correct pronunciation and practice it in a natural setting.
Innovative Techniques for Pronunciation Correction
- Interactive Dialogue Simulations: Using digital platforms that simulate conversations with AI or virtual characters allows students to practice pronunciation in varied scenarios.
- Peer Feedback in Group Dialogues: Small group activities where students listen to each other’s pronunciation and provide constructive feedback fosters a collaborative learning environment.
- Video and Audio Recording: Encouraging students to record their dialogues enables self-assessment and identification of pronunciation errors.
- Real-time Visual Feedback: Technologies that display pronunciation waveforms or articulatory movements help students adjust their speech instantly.
